CHVI-FM
CHVI-FM (Spirit FM) is a Canadian radio station, which broadcasts a low-power Christian radio format on the frequency of 88.7 FM/ MHz in Campbell River, British Columbia Campbell River, or Wiwek̓a̱m, is a city in British Columbia on the east coast of Vancouver Island at the south end of Discovery Passage, which lies along the 50th parallel north along the important Inside Passage shipping route. Campbell River ..., with an effective radiated power of 50 watts. The manager of Spirit FM and president of Total Change Ministries is Terry Somerville. Owned by Total Change Christian Ministries, the station received CRTC approval on October 15, 2010, and began broadcasting on April 8, 2011. References External linksSpirit FMTotal Change

Christian Radio
Christian radio is a Christian media radio format that focus on programming with a Christian message. Many such broadcasters play contemporary Christian music, though many programs include sermons, radio dramas, as well as news and talk programming covering popular culture, economic, and political topics from a Christian perspective. Business models Brokered programming is a significant portion of most U.S. Christian radio stations' revenue, with stations regularly selling blocks of airtime to evangelists seeking an audience. Another revenue stream is solicitation of donations, either to the evangelists who buy the air time or to the stations or their owners themselves. In order to further encourage donations, certain evangelists may emphasize the prosperity gospel, in which they preach that tithing and donations to the ministry will result in financial blessings from God. Hertz
The hertz (symbol: Hz) is the unit of frequency in the International System of Units (SI), equivalent to one event (or cycle) per second. The hertz is an SI derived unit whose expression in terms of SI base units is s−1, meaning that one hertz is the reciprocal of one second. It is named after Heinrich Rudolf Hertz (1857–1894), the first person to provide conclusive proof of the existence of electromagnetic waves. Hertz are commonly expressed in multiples: kilohertz (kHz), megahertz (MHz), gigahertz (GHz), terahertz (THz). Some of the unit's most common uses are in the description of periodic waveforms and musical tones, particularly those used in radio- and audio-related applications. It is also used to describe the clock speeds at which computers and other electronics are driven. CRTC
The Canadian Radio-television and Telecommunications Commission (CRTC; french: Conseil de la radiodiffusion et des télécommunications canadiennes, links=) is a public organization in Canada with mandate as a regulatory agency for broadcasting and telecommunications. It was created in 1976 when it took over responsibility for regulating telecommunication carriers. Prior to 1976, it was known as the Canadian Radio and Television Commission, which was established in 1968 by the Parliament of Canada to replace the Board of Broadcast Governors. Its headquarters is located in the Central Building (Édifice central) of Les Terrasses de la Chaudière in Gatineau, Quebec. History The CRTC was originally known as the Canadian Radio-Television Commission. Watt
The watt (symbol: W) is the unit of power or radiant flux in the International System of Units (SI), equal to 1 joule per second or 1 kg⋅m2⋅s−3. It is used to quantify the rate of energy transfer. The watt is named after James Watt (1736–1819), an 18th-century Scottish inventor, mechanical engineer, and chemist who improved the Newcomen engine with his own steam engine in 1776. Watt's invention was fundamental for the Industrial Revolution. Low-power Broadcasting
Low-power broadcasting is broadcasting by a broadcast station at a low transmitter power output to a smaller service area than "full power" stations within the same region. It is often distinguished from "micropower broadcasting" (more commonly " microbroadcasting") and broadcast translators. LPAM, LPFM and LPTV are in various levels of use across the world, varying widely based on the laws and their enforcement. Canada Radio communications in Canada are regulated by the Radio Communications and Broadcasting Regulatory Branch, a branch of Industry Canada, in conjunction with the Canadian Radio-television and Telecommunications Commission (CRTC). Interested parties must apply for both a certificate from Industry Canada and a license from CRTC in order to operate a radio station. Industry Canada manages the technicalities of spectrum space and technological requirements whereas content regulation is conducted more so by CRTC. FM Broadcasting
FM broadcasting is a method of radio broadcasting using frequency modulation (FM). Invented in 1933 by American engineer Edwin Armstrong, wide-band FM is used worldwide to provide high fidelity sound over broadcast radio. FM broadcasting is capable of higher fidelity—that is, more accurate reproduction of the original program sound—than other broadcasting technologies, such as AM broadcasting. It is also less susceptible to common forms of interference, reducing static and popping sounds often heard on AM. Therefore, FM is used for most broadcasts of music or general audio (in the audio spectrum). FM radio stations use the very high frequency range of radio frequencies. Broadcast bands Throughout the world, the FM broadcast band falls within the VHF part of the radio spectrum.
